GE 207 - Materials Laboratory

Description:
Experimental techniques for measuring the stresses, strains and deflections associated with tension, compression, bending and torsion in structural members. Course is designed to supplement mechanics of materials classroom work with experimental verification and visualization. Emphasis is on practical application, laboratory technique, safety, data-handling and report-writing. As the first of the engineering laboratory classes, this course represents an important introduction to hands-on engineering experimentation. Prerequisites: GE 206 or concurrent registration.
